然而,在实际安装过程中,不少用户遭遇了“Hyper-V安装不成功”的困扰
这不仅影响了工作效率,还可能引发一系列后续问题
本文将深入探讨Hyper-V安装不成功的原因,并提供一系列切实可行的解决方案,帮助用户突破这一困境
一、Hyper-V安装不成功的常见原因 1.系统兼容性问题 Hyper-V对硬件和操作系统的要求较为严格
如果用户的计算机不满足最低配置要求,或者操作系统版本不支持Hyper-V,那么安装过程很可能失败
例如,Windows 10的家庭版并不包含Hyper-V功能,用户需要升级到专业版或更高版本才能使用
2.BIOS/UEFI设置问题 某些BIOS/UEFI设置可能会影响Hyper-V的安装和运行
例如,虚拟化技术(如Intel VT-x或AMD-V)需要在BIOS/UEFI中启用,否则Hyper-V无法正常工作
3.冲突的软件或服务 某些软件或服务可能与Hyper-V产生冲突,导致安装失败
这些冲突可能来自防病毒软件、其他虚拟化软件(如VMware)、或者某些系统服务
4.损坏的安装文件 如果安装文件在下载或复制过程中损坏,那么安装过程也会失败
此外,系统更新不完整或损坏也可能导致Hyper-V安装问题
5.权限问题 安装Hyper-V需要管理员权限
如果用户没有足够的权限,或者安装过程中未以管理员身份运行安装程序,那么安装可能会失败
二、解决Hyper-V安装不成功的方法 针对上述原因,我们可以采取以下措施来解决Hyper-V安装不成功的问题: 1.检查系统兼容性 - 确保计算机满足Hyper-V的最低配置要求
- 检查操作系统版本是否支持Hyper-V
如果使用的是Windows 10家庭版,可以考虑升级到专业版或更高版本
2.检查并更新BIOS/UEFI设置 - 进入计算机的BIOS/UEFI设置界面
- 查找并启用虚拟化技术(如Intel VT-x或AMD-V)
- 保存设置并重启计算机
3.卸载冲突的软件或服务 - 暂时禁用或卸载防病毒软件,然后尝试安装Hyper-V
- 如果计算机上安装了其他虚拟化软件(如VMware),请将其卸载或禁用,以避免与Hyper-V产生冲突
- 检查系统服务,确保没有与Hyper-V冲突的服务正在运行
4.修复或重新下载安装文件 - 如果安装文件损坏,可以尝试重新下载或从其他可靠来源获取安装文件
- 确保系统更新完整且未损坏
可以使用系统自带的更新工具检查并修复更新问题
5.以管理员身份运行安装程序 - 右击安装程序图标,选择“以管理员身份运行”
- 确保在安装过程中拥有足够的权限
三、详细操作步骤与案例分析 为了更好地说明解决过程,以下提供一个详细的案例分析和操作步骤: 案例一:系统兼容性问题导致安装失败 - 问题描述:用户尝试在Windows 10家庭版上安装Hyper-V,但安装失败
解决方案: 1. 检查操作系统版本,确认是家庭版
2. 升级到Windows 10专业版或更高版本
3. 重新下载Hyper-V安装文件并尝试安装
结果:安装成功,Hyper-V功能正常使用
案例二:BIOS/UEFI设置问题导致安装失败 - 问题描述:用户计算机满足Hyper-V配置要求,但安装过程中提示虚拟化技术未启用
解决方案: 1. 进入计算机BIOS/UEFI设置界面
2. 查找并启用Intel VT-x或AMD-V虚拟化技术
3. 保存设置并重启计算机
4. 尝试重新安装Hyper-V
结果:安装成功,Hyper-V功能正常使用
案例三:冲突软件导致安装失败 - 问题描述:用户计算机上安装了VMware和防病毒软件,尝试安装Hyper-V时失败
解决方案: 1. 暂时禁用防病毒软件
2. 卸载VMware软件
3. 尝试重新安装Hyper-V
4. 如果安装成功,可以逐步排查并确定具体是哪个软件与Hyper-V产生冲突
- 结果:安装成功,确认是VMware与Hyper-V产生冲突
用户选择保留Hyper-V并卸载VMware
四、预防措施与后续建议 为了避免Hyper-V安装不成功的问题再次发生,以下是一些预防措施和后续建议: 1.定期检查系统更新:确保操作系统和Hyper-V都保持最新版本,以修复可能存在的漏洞和兼容性问题
2.注意软件兼容性:在安装新的软件或服务时,注意检查是否与Hyper-V兼容
如果不确定,可以先在测试环境中进行安装和测试
3.备份重要数据:在进行系统更新、安装新软件或修改BIOS/UEFI设置之前,务必备份重要数据,以防万一
4.定期维护系统:定期清理系统垃圾文件